Output c594fb55bd8392e9e1485f78a5592f5d6a918ba02f6188f258b7e17f597eb55c:1

value
13343692
script pubkey
OP_0 OP_PUSHBYTES_20 0dd9420d42c5ddc76b62d2c8c2d472ad6c8d301a
address
bc1qphv5yr2zchwuw6mz6tyv94rj44kg6vq6hwh2v9
transaction
c594fb55bd8392e9e1485f78a5592f5d6a918ba02f6188f258b7e17f597eb55c
spent
true